ID12RFID with interrupts

Fork of ID12RFID by Simon Ford

Files at this revision

API Documentation at this revision

Comitter:
jnagendran3
Date:
Wed Dec 03 22:39:10 2014 +0000
Parent:
1:f04afa911cf5
Commit message:
Additional code for generating interrupts.

Changed in this revision

ID12RFID.cpp Show annotated file Show diff for this revision Revisions of this file
ID12RFID.h Show annotated file Show diff for this revision Revisions of this file
diff -r f04afa911cf5 -r b801dd21f6cc ID12RFID.cpp
--- a/ID12RFID.cpp	Tue Nov 23 17:17:15 2010 +0000
+++ b/ID12RFID.cpp	Wed Dec 03 22:39:10 2014 +0000
@@ -51,3 +51,7 @@
     
     return v;
 }
+
+void ID12RFID::setInterrupt(void (*fptr)()) {
+    _rfid.attach(fptr);
+}
diff -r f04afa911cf5 -r b801dd21f6cc ID12RFID.h
--- a/ID12RFID.h	Tue Nov 23 17:17:15 2010 +0000
+++ b/ID12RFID.h	Wed Dec 03 22:39:10 2014 +0000
@@ -64,6 +64,8 @@
      * @return The ID tag value
      */
     int read();
+    
+    void setInterrupt(void (fptr)());
 
 private:
     Serial _rfid;